What will you do?

As a Benefits Form Filler, you will be providing essential support to residents who need help to receive the financial help they need. After appropriate training, you will help residents to complete disability and sickness applications, grants and travel support. 

● Attend training and keep up to date, supported as part of a team 

● Fill in paper or online forms for Attendance Allowance, Personal Independence Payments, Limited Capability for Work, discretionary housing payments 

● Complete benefit checks to identify any other help

● Apply for charity and other grants or other help such  

 ● Support people either in person at one of our offices or community locations, by phone or video
